1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When is the problem/conflict first introduced to the reader?
Back
Exposition
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The series of events that build tension and lead up to the climax, often including obstacles and complications faced by the protagonist.
Back
Rising Action
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The turning point of the story, where the main conflict reaches its peak and a major decision is made.
Back
Climax
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the exposition introduce?
Back
Characters, setting, and problem/conflict
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which part of the Plot Diagram usually has the most events?
Back
Rising Action
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which part of the story is represented by this blue area? Options: exposition, rising action, climax, resolution
Back
exposition
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
plot
Back
The sequence of events in a story
